Phase 3 - Eye of Shartuul

When you defeat the Shivan Assassin and took control of it, a portal will open outside of the 'arena'. This portal summons Shartuul to the location to watch over what is happening and send more reinforcements. At this point, Shartuul will summon a beholder-like boss called Eye of Shartuul at the left side of the transporter. This starts the 3rd phase.

Boss Strategy:

This is one of the most easiest phases in the Shartuul event. Start off with Aspect of the Shadow. As soon as you can engage the Eye of Shartuul, immediately apply a Siphon Life and cast Shadow Nova while in a close range from it (but not too close, or you can get hit by its Tongue Lash and gain a debuff increasing magic damage taken by 50%). As soon as these 2 spells are applied, change to Aspect of Flame and start stacking up Flame Buffets on it while staying away from its melee range. If ever you get a debuff from him, cleanse it right away.

Keep on moving and when it starts to fire a yellow beam on the ground where you're stepping on, move away immediately. This is its Disruption Ray ability which sets up a stun trap on that location. If you stand in the trap's location, you will get periodically stunned, so keep away from these. Keep stacking Flame Buffets and casting Pyroblast while waiting for the Flame Buffet cooldown until he starts a raid warning-like emote "Eye of Shartuul focuses intensely!". When you see this, the Eye of Shartuul is about to cast Dark Glare, which is an ability that deals huge damage. Switch over to Aspect of the Ice as soon as you see the emote, and cast Ice Block when there is less than 4 seconds left on its Dark Glare casting. When he casts it, the spell will get reflected and will deal moderate damage to the eye, while you stay unharmed.

As soon as you get out of Ice Block, wait for the Aspect of the Shadow cooldown and switch over to it when its finally up. Once you're back to Aspect of the Shadow, cast Death Blast immediately and wait for the Siphon Life debuff to get consumed and heal you. As soon as it gets consumed, reapply Siphon Life and repeat the cycle. Shift to Flame aspect, stack up Flame Buffets and cast Pyroblasts while kiting, switch to Ice aspect and use Ice Block when it starts to cast Dark Glare, then return to Shadow aspect to cast Death Blast to heal up. Rinse and repeat. Just avoid the Disruption Ray traps and keep your distance from the eye and this boss fight is a piece of cake.

Phase 4 - Dreadmaw

After defeating the Eye of Shartuul, Shartuul will send out another boss immediately. This time, its a corehound-like boss called Dreadmaw which Shartuul summons at the right side of the transporter.

Boss Strategy:

The easiest phase in all of Shartuul event. You just need to kite this slow-moving hound all around the place. Just like the previous boss, start of with Aspect of the Shadow to put Siphon Life up on it. After applying Siphon Life, switch over to Aspect of Flame and start kiting. Dreadmaw moves very, very, very slow so you shouldn't have problems kiting in Flame aspect. Stack up Flame Buffets and hit it with Pyroblasts from a distance. When he finally emotes "Dreadmaw lashes out...", he will charge at you and apply a debuff that slows down your movement. When this happens, cleanse it quick and move out of his melee range.

Switch over back to Aspect of the Shadow and cast Death Blast to keep yourself topped off. Wait for the Siphon Life to get consumed before reapplying so it won't go to waste and get a kiting sequence done without a Siphon Life up. Rinse and repeat. This phase only involves switching to 2 aspects so its very easy. Throughout the fight, you will notice Dreadmaw growing in size. This increases its physical damage, but don't let it intimidate you and just continue kiting. He shouldn't reach you within melee range, except when he lashes out and charges on to you. At that point, just cleanse immediately and resume kiting.

Final Phase - Shartuul

After defeating his two pets, Shartuul will now enter the field and deal with you himself. But before entering, he will throw out a large ball on top of the transporter which will disintegrate and spread out on to the arena. These small bits eventually becomes Fel Eye Stalks, which casts Mind Flay on you if you're within range from them. A single Shadow Nova will clear out an area of the Fel Eye Stalks, so you'll be safe from the Mind Flays. Shartuul refreshes the eye stalks periodically so get ready for them. Shartuul is a caster boss, so you don't have to do any kiting here. Instead, you just need to clear out an area of Fel Stalks and stand there safely without Mind Flays. Its recommended to clear out the area near Shartuul, so if ever he casts Magnetic Pull, you're still safe from eye stalks' Mind Flays.

Shartuul's Abilities:

Shadowbolt - Shartuul's main offensive spell. He will be casting this spell almost always. Deals weak shadow damage.

Shadow Resonance - Shartuul's debuff spell that he casts occasionally. It increases shadow damage taken by 10000. Can stack up to 3. Should be removed immediately by Cleansing Flame.

Immolate - Shartuul's secondary offensive spell. He will cast this occasionally. Deals moderate fire damage and leaves a DoT on the Shivan Assassin which deals around 1% per tick for 21 seconds. This can really drain the life of the Shivan Assassin if not cleansed immediately.

Magnetic Pull - Shartuul's ability which instantly pulls you to his current location. Also, as soon as you get pulled, Shartuul will teleport to a different location in the arena. Can be bad if he pulls you to a location filled with eye stalks.

Incinerate - Shartuul's nuke spell. This is as deadly as Eye of Shartuul's Dark Glare, so this spell should and always be Ice Blocked. There's no definite interval on how often he uses this ability, but if ever he uses it, he will shout an emote "Get ready to be incinerated!...". That should be your signal to switch to Aspect of the Ice and get ready to Ice Block.

Boss Strategy:

At this point, you should be familiar to switching aspects, as you will be switching almost always while fighting Shartuul. As soon as he enters the playing area, get a Siphon Life and a Shadow Nova debuff up on him, then switch to Flame aspect. Start stacking up Flame Buffets and hit him with Pyroblasts while waiting for the Flame Buffet spell to cooldown. When he applies the Shadow Resonance debuff or Immolate on you, cleanse it immediately.

Keep stacking Flame Buffets and wait for his Incinerate emote. When he emotes for it, switch to Ice aspect and get ready to Ice Block. After reflecting his Incinerate, Ice Leap and get an Iceblast out before switching out to Shadow aspect again. Cast Death Blast on Shartuul and wait till the Siphon Life gets consumed. Reapply Siphon Life and cast Shadow Nova on the area near Shartuul to clear out the eye stalks. Switch over to Flame aspect and cleanse off debuffs if there are any.

Continue stacking Flame Buffets until you get 10 stacks then Pyroblast away. If ever he replants the eye stalks, change to Shadow aspect and clear the location out with Shadow Nova. Death Blast the Siphon Life off and reapply after it gets consumed. If he emotes his Incinerate spell, switch over to Ice aspect immediately and Ice Block it off. If you can't make it in time and switching to Ice aspect is still on cooldown, just take the damage and get ready to heal up later.

Whenever you get a debuff, change to Flame aspect immediately and cleanse it off. You should be adapting to the situation when you need to change aspects. If you have a debuff, change to Flame aspect and cleanse immediately. If he's about to cast Incinerate, switch to Ice aspect and Ice Block the incoming Incinerate. If he replants eye stalks, switch over to Shadow aspect, Shadow Nova the area, Death Blast and reapply Siphon Life after getting healed.

This boss fight is all about switching to forms depending on the situation. If you still have high enough health and he replants eye stalks while you still have debuffs, cleanse them all off first before clearing the area with Shadow Nova. Cleansing debuffs is more important than the Mind Flays, and Ice Blocking Incinerate is more important than anything else.

If ever your health drops down too low (around 30-40% or so), setup a full heal by getting a Siphon Life up, then using Chaos Strike, then finishing off with a massive heal with a Death Blast right after doing a Chaos Strike with a Siphon Life debuff up. Once you're back to full health, repeat the process and reapply Siphon Life, then cleansing when needed. You should be in Aspect of the Flame more often and longer than being in any other aspect, since this is the only aspect where you can attack Shartuul with Pyroblasts while cleansing any debuffs he places on you. Keep your focus and continue the routine, and you'll defeat Shartuul eventually.



Rewards

Every after transferring control to a new demon, you will get Apexis Shards. The first transfer is 20 Apexis Shards, while the second and final transfer is 40 Shards. Killing Shartuul gets you a random depleted item, plus a random loot plus a little cash. If you're lucky, you can get an epic ring from him. You can basically get a chance off Shartuul every day, depending on your luck on the Darkrune / Darkrune Fragments. This can be an easy way to make money, for selling these Bind-on-Equip items directly, or just sharding them and selling / keeping the shard. Good luck on your Shartuul attempts!

Depleted Item and Infused Item List
Depleted Badge -> Badge of Tenacity (Trinket)
308 Armor, On Use: Increases Agility by 150 for 20 seconds

Depleted Cloak -> Crystalweave Cape (Back)
78 Armor, 15 Agility, 15 Stamina, 26 Haste Rating

Depleted Dagger -> Crystal-Infused Shiv (Dagger)
103-155 (71.7 DPS) Damage, 1.80 Speed, 11 Agility, 12 Stamina, 40 Attack Power

Depleted Mace -> Apexis Crystal Mace (One-hand Mace)
90-168 (71.7 DPS) Damage, 1.80 Speed, 8 Hit Rating, 20 Critical Strike Rating, 22 Attack Power

Depleted Ring -> Dreamcrystal Band (Ring)
10 Intellect, 15 Spell Critical Strike Rating, 37 Nature damage

Depleted Staff -> Flaming Quartz Staff (Staff)
92-172 (62.8 DPS) Damage, 2.10 Speed, 28 Stamina, 46 Intellect, 26 Spell Critical Strike Rating, 121 Spell damage / healing

Depleted Sword -> Crystalforged Sword (One-hand Sword)
35-114 (41.4 DPS) Damage, 1.80 Speed, 30 Stamina, 8 Intellect, 11 Shield Block Rating, 121 Spell damage / healing

Depleted Two-Handed Axe -> Apexis Cleaver (Two-hand Axe)
268-403 (93.2 DPS) Damage, 3.60 Speed, 46 Strength, 39 Stamina, 19 Critical Strike Rating

Depleted Cloth Bracers -> Crystalweave Bracers (Cloth, Wrist)
78 Armor, 16 Intellect, 1 Red Socket (2 Spell Damage socket bonus), 12 Spell Critical Strike Rating, 23 Spell damage / healing

Depleted Mail Gauntlets -> Crystalhide Handwraps (Mail, Hands)
465 Armor, 11 Agility, 27 Intellect, 2 Red Sockets (3 Intellect socket bonus), 56 Attack Power
